Bohemian Birthday

This turned out to be a simple masculine birthday card.  I used my MISTI to line up the diamond stamps on the left.  I kept the stamps on the cover, but moved the paper each time so that everything came out straight up and down.

To line up the birthday greeting on the acrylic block, I first lined it up (smooth side up) on my grid paper.  Then I pressed the block, which has grid lines etched on one side, onto the stamp so that I could keep it straight along the diamond strip.  To finish off the card, I mounted the panel with dimensionals on a light green card (looks white here) and added the sequins.
